Commercial Description:
WinterVrund a royal beer from Limburg (southern part of Holland). A mix of top and bottom fermentation. Brewed at the end of the year with a different recipe every year. Best to be enjoyed with friends ("frun" in Limburgs) giving you a warming feeling inside for the cold winter months. Wintervrund is like all our beers unpasteurised and environment friendly brewed. The best temperature to drink Wintervrund is between 10 and 12 °C. NOTE: 2007 is actually released in the winter 2007/2008.
